Effects of a bodybalance training program on pain, knee instability, and hip and knee muscle strength in older women with knee osteoarthritis
Parvin Safarpour , Farzaneh Saki * , Leila Youzbashi
Faculty of Sports Science, Bu-Ali Sina University, Hamedan, Iran , ‌f_saki@basu.ac.ir
Abstract:   (9 Views)
Background and aims: Muscle weakness is a common problem in older adults with knee osteoarthritis and can contribute to reduced knee stability and increased pain. This study investigated the effects of BodyBalance exercise on pain, knee instability, and hip and knee muscle strength in older women with knee osteoarthritis.
Methods: This quasi-experimental, pretest–posttest study included experimental and control groups. Forty older women with knee osteoarthritis were randomly assigned to the experimental or control group. The experimental group attended 60-minute BodyBalance training sessions three times weekly for 12 weeks, while the control group continued their usual daily activities. Pain, knee instability, and muscle strength were assessed using the Visual Analog Scale (VAS), a 6-point self-reported instability scale, and a handheld dynamometer, respectively. Data were analyzed with repeated-measures analysis of variance (ANOVA) and paired t-tests.
Results: BodyBalance training produced significant increases in hip and knee muscle strength and significant reductions in pain and knee instability (p<0.001). Improvements in the experimental group were significantly greater than those observed in the control group.
Conclusion: BodyBalance exercises are effective, noninvasive interventions for improving knee stability, reducing pain, and enhancing lower-extremity muscle strength in older adults with knee osteoarthritis, and may help maintain physical function and prevent disability.
Keywords: Knee osteoarthritis, muscle strength, lower limb, postural balance, exercise therapy
